What I Am ReadingMy reading list for 2026 can be found here. One of the books I chose was unintentionally a way of life I was already living. The Wardrobe Project: A Year of Buying Less and Liking Yourself More by Emma Edwards. Last year I went to Tonga and Vanuatu for a few months then travelled across to Perth. I selected 3 dresses, a coverup shirt, 2 singlet tops, 2 exercise outfits, 2 swimmers, sandals, sneakers (plus 2 pairs of socks), 2 lava lavas and underwear. The items I chose were multi-purpose e.g the dresses can be worn as skirts, strapless or with the coverall top for different looks. They are also designed that as I lose weight, they can be adjusted. Since arriving in Perth, I still haven't bought anything. I haven't looked at clothes much and haven't felt a strong desire to change things up. I am not comparing myself as much to others and less interested in shopping at all.
